I see you dropped debian/patches/01-sigc_namespace.patch, saying that it has been merged upstream. This doesn't appear to be the case though. In your new source package it seems you added debian/patches/debian-changes-1.6.0-0ubuntu1, which has the same contents as the patch you dropped.
This patch was autogenerated when you built the source package. I think what has happened is you checked the source code with the original patch applied (perhaps without realising it) and then deleted the patch, thinking that it had been included upstream.
